Alabama: A police officer was injured during an arrest near downtown Dothan Wednesday afternoon.
Officers were called to the 1100 block of Blackshear Street, behind the Piggly Wiggly on Montgomery Highway, after police say dispatch received a call about a woman getting into vehicles on a property.
Dothan Police say when responding officers tried to detain the woman, she started resisting, and one officer broke his ankle during the struggle.
During the incident, two other officers experienced βbrief medical symptomsβ and were evaluated by first responders. Both officers are undergoing routine medical assessments.

LATEST: Three officers were injured Wednesday during an incident in Pittsylvania County, Virginia.
Pittsylvania County Sheriff Mike Taylor said three officers went to 611 Blue Jay Lane to serve warrants and a protective order. As soon as they approached the home, officials say they were met with gunfire.
Officers reported two had been struck by shrapnel. One of those officers was taken to the ER out of caution; that officer has been released.
Officials said the officers were shaken up, but luckily, they only sustained superficial shrapnel wounds.

Aug. 13, 1965 - Two thousand National Guardsmen with fixed bayonets moved into Los Angeles tonight to battle rioters in the burning and looted Getto area.
The Guardsmen were under orders to use rifles, machine guns, tear gas, and bayonets in support of a battered contingent of 900 policemen and deputy sheriffs.
Four persons were killed in the rioting today, including three rioters and a police officer. Thirty-three police officers had been injured, 75 civilians seriously injured, and 249 rioters had been arrested. This morning, violence spread to white areas.
Gangs of rioters appeared tonight in various parts of Los Angeles County, up to 20 miles from the riot scene in the Watts district. One group of about 25 rioters started tossing rocks in San Pedro in the harbor area, while another group appeared in Pacoima, a Black community in the San Fernando Valley. Police units dispersed these groups.
The National Guardsmen were brought into the riot zone in small convoys led by jeeps with machine guns mounted on them. The convoys contained one or two troop carriers. One Guard unit opened machine-gun fire for 10 minutes on a gang of rioters who then fled down the street.
One Guardsman said the rioters fired with pistols and at least one rifle. No one was apparently hit. The Guardsmen continued tonight to penetrate the riot area.
βTheyβve got weapons and ammo,β one Guard spokesman said. βItβs going to be like Vietnam.β
A National Guard spokesman said that, besides the 2,000 men in the area, thousands more were on their way.
The Guard, he said, plans to βhit them and make them stop.β
Throughout the Getto section, crowds numbering in the thousands were chanting, βWhite devils, what are you doing here?β
Unlike many race riots, the south Los Angeles melee has no main combat front.
βItβs guerrilla warfare,β said Police Chief William Parker.
